Goldman Sachs
Average total pay: $129,000
For: Other Exempt (Analyst, Program Analyst and Associate)*

Best companies rank: 36

This investment bank has attracted recent fame for its notoriously-high executive compensation. Analyst pay of $129,000 is in the lowest tier of the company's pay scale.

Goldman is undoubtedly an industry leader; CEO Lloyd C. Blankfein received a $53.4 million bonus for 2006, and two other high-ranking Goldman officers, Gary Cohn and Jon Winkelried, each received $25.7 million in restricted stock and options. According to The New York Times, Goldman's average payout dwarfed by 2-to-1 comparable payouts at competitors Bear Stearns and Lehman Bros.

*Most common salaried job
